Incorporating charitable giving into your estate plan is a powerful way to leave a lasting legacy and support causes that matter most to you. Whether through a bequest in your Will, a Charitable Remainder Trust, or naming a nonprofit organization as a beneficiary of an IRA or life insurance policy, planned giving can offer both personal fulfillment and potential tax advantages for your estate. It’s also a thoughtful opportunity to model generosity and purpose for the next generation. With proper planning, you can ensure that your values continue to make an impact long after you’re gone.
